I’m 52 with post-menopausal, mature skin, and I already use the Sulwhasoo First Care Activating Serum and Concentrated Ginseng Serum, so I was very curious how this mask would fit into my routine. It did not disappoint. This mask feels exactly like you’d expect from Sulwhasoo — refined, nourishing, and very well formulated. The sheet itself is high quality and fits comfortably without slipping, and it’s generously soaked without dripping everywhere. After removing it, my skin feels deeply hydrated and calm, not sticky or overloaded. There’s an immediate plumpness and softness, and my skin just looks healthier overall. It’s one of those masks where you don’t feel the need to rush into moisturizer right away because your skin already feels balanced and comfortable. I especially like using this on nights when my skin feels a little dry, tired, or after actives. It pairs beautifully with the First Care and Ginseng serums — almost like an extension of that routine rather than a random add-on. The glow the next morning is noticeable, and fine lines look softened simply because my skin is so well hydrated. This is definitely a repurchase for me. If you already love Sulwhasoo’s First Care line and have mature or dry skin, this mask is absolutely worth trying. It feels luxurious, effective, and very on brand for Sulwhasoo.

Love these masks - Great for long haul flights to keep face moisturized.
I absolutely love these masks. They are super hydrating. Each mask contains the equivalent of three weeks' worth of Sulwhasoo's iconic First Care Activating Serum. This serum is designed to boost the skin's natural barrier and promote a healthy, youthful appearance. Great for long haul flights or if you have a special occasion and need to plump up the skin. The mask sheet is made from 100% naturally derived Paper Mulberry, a material known for its water-binding properties. This helps the mask retain moisture and deliver the serum effectively to the skin. The mask is formulated to be gentle and effective for all skin types, including sensitive skin. I keep mine in the fridge for extra cooling effect. Will reorder.

Sideways, but Satisfied
I really enjoyed this mask experience. It felt great — a little tingly and smelled nice. However, it was a bit unwieldy, and I accidentally ripped it while trying to position it on my face correctly. I must confess, I initially applied it sideways. In my defense, there isn't a clear indication of its correct orientation unless you fully unfold it before application, especially since it was soaked and dripping with moisturizer. The mask left my face feeling incredibly moisturized, but it took some time for it to fully absorb. A few observations I made: the instructions recommend to cleanse your face beforehand. I believe it's best to apply the mask after showering, as you won't rinse off the treatment afterward. Given this, it's more akin to a spa treatment. I think one should allocate ample time not just for application but also for the absorption process, considering the potential risk of it getting on one's hair and clothes. I’m very happy with this product and I do think it’s worth trying despite it’s somewhat high cost, especially since I think my frequency of use would be more like 1x a month instead of the 1-2x a week recommendation from Sulwhasoo.

A bit like a (good) facial at home
When I go get a facial the most important part for me is probably the relaxation, the massage, the pampering. Second to that, my skin is always well hydrated, plumped, and feeling good after. If for you thos priorities are swapped, this mask may be well worth the cost for you. The masks come out to $12 each which is quite pricey compared to others that claim to do the same thing. This is absolutely the most moisturizing, hydrating mask I have ever used though. This leaves my skin feeling post-facial good except for the massage part. I do notice that it feels a little tingly on, but nothing annoying. The mask has to be pulled around a bit to get the fit right. Even then, it's not really cut for every face. It overlapped the edges of my eyes a bit, but no serum got into my eyes or anything. This has plenty of serum left in the envelope to massage some in to my neck and hands as well. I also made a point of massaging in the serum that was left on my face after I removed the mask. When I used this in the morning, I found that I needed to wait about an hour or so after use before my skin wasn't tacky anymore. Then I put some sunscreen on and headed out for the day. This is a good rescue when my skin starts to get dull or tired, but it's too costly for me to use often.
